Gao won the 2000 Nobel Prize in Literature, the first Chinese author to do so. Originally published in Chinese as "Lingshan" about a decade earlier, the novel was translated to English by Mabel Lee and published in the US in 2000. The novel, about a journey to the fabled Lingshan mountain (known as "Soul Mountain" where, according to legend, people would come to pray and would have their prayer's answered), is partially autobiographical and partially fictional.
